Spring Highlights
MAIN ST. Fort Worth Arts Festival —
April 16–19, 2026
A nationally recognized arts festival showcasing incredible artists, live
performances, and vibrant downtown energy.
Mayfest — April 30–May 3, 2026
A family-favorite festival held in Trinity Park with live music, food vendors,
carnival rides, and outdoor fun.
Butterflies in the Garden —
March–April 2026
Experience a seasonal exhibit filled with thousands of butterflies at the Fort
Worth Botanic Garden—perfect for all ages.
FEI World Cup Finals — April 8–12,
2026
A world-class equestrian event bringing international competition and
excitement to Dickies Arena.
Summer Events
Charles Schwab Challenge — May 25–31,
2026
A premier PGA Tour golf tournament attracting top players and fans from across
the country.
Juneteenth Celebration — June 19, 2026
Celebrate culture, history, and community with events honoring freedom and
heritage across Fort Worth.
Fort Worth Fourth — July 4, 2026
A spectacular Independence Day celebration featuring fireworks, live music, and
family-friendly activities.
National Day of the American Cowboy —
July 25, 2026
Celebrate Fort Worth’s Western roots with rodeo events, entertainment, and
cowboy culture in the Stockyards.
Concerts & Live Entertainment —
Summer 2026
From major touring artists to local performances, venues across Fort Worth host
an exciting lineup of live shows all season long.
Fall Favorites & Local Experiences
Fort Worth Oktoberfest — September
24–26, 2026
A lively German-inspired festival featuring beer, food, music, and traditional
entertainment.
Red Steagall Cowboy Gathering &
Western Swing Festival — Fall 2026
Celebrate cowboy culture with music, storytelling, and Western heritage
experiences.
Art Festivals & Cultural Events —
Fall 2026
Events like Art Fort Worth and other cultural showcases highlight the city’s
thriving creative scene.
Sporting Events & Shows — Fall
2026
From rodeos at Cowtown Coliseum to major arena events, Fort Worth continues to
host exciting entertainment throughout the season.
Holiday & Seasonal Celebrations
Lone Star International Film Festival
— November 2026
A premier film event bringing independent films, filmmakers, and movie lovers
together in Fort Worth.
Holiday Events & Performances —
December 2026
Enjoy festive traditions like concerts, theatrical performances, and seasonal
markets throughout the city.
New Year’s Celebrations — December 31,
2026
Ring in the new year with lively events, entertainment, and celebrations across
Fort Worth’s downtown and entertainment districts.
